Western Railway to Revise Mumbai Local Timetable From September 1

news18.com

Western Railway will implement a revised suburban train timetable on September 1, 2026, adding six new services and withdrawing six others while keeping the total number of services at 1,414. The new services include two Up and four Down trains, with additions like a Bhayandar-Virar service and a late-night Virar-Borivali run. Six existing services, including two AC Fast trains, will be withdrawn, while AC services increase from 145 to 147 with two new additions. Several routes will be extended, including some services now running to Churchgate, and certain AC and fast trains will skip Borivali station. Commuters are advised to check the revised timetable before traveling.
